Fiberlogy R PET-G is an eco-friendly 3D printing filament made from 100% recycled material sourced from carefully selected suppliers. It combines the high mechanical and chemical resistance of PET-G with ease of printing, attractive print appearance, and a lower price. The product may vary in shade and contain trace amounts of glitter, which is due to the nature of the raw material. Ideal for users looking for functional, durable, and cost-effective solutions.

Fiberlogy PC/ABS is an engineering filament that combines the strength of polycarbonate (PC) with the ease of printing and durability of ABS. It offers exceptional impact strength, chemical resistance, and thermal stability up to 110°C, making it ideal for demanding industrial and prototyping applications.

Fiberlogy PCTG is a modern 3D printing filament that serves as the best alternative to PET-G. It offers higher impact strength, temperature resistance, and crystalline transparency, while maintaining ease of printing and low shrinkage. Ideal for durable, functional, and aesthetically pleasing prints, even on home 3D printers.

Fiberlogy PCTG+CF is a 3D printing filament that combines the versatility of PCTG with the strength of carbon fiber. Thanks to its 10% carbon content, it offers greater stiffness, tensile strength, and precise, shrinkage-free prints—even in printers without an enclosed chamber. The finished models impress with their technical excellence and carbon-fiber finish, making this filament ideal for demanding users.
